This Professional Certificate in Urban Mobility Crisis Communication equips professionals with the crucial skills to manage and mitigate communication challenges during transportation disruptions. The program focuses on developing effective strategies for crisis response and risk communication within the urban mobility sector.
Learning outcomes include mastering crisis communication planning, understanding diverse stakeholder engagement, and developing proficiency in media relations and social media management during a crisis. Participants will learn to analyze urban mobility risks, craft impactful messaging, and implement effective communication strategies to minimize the impact of disruptions on the public.
The program's duration is typically structured to allow for flexible learning, often spanning several weeks or months, depending on the specific course structure and delivery method. This allows professionals to integrate their learning with their existing workloads.
The certificate holds significant industry relevance, catering to professionals in transportation planning, public transit agencies, emergency management, and city governments. Graduates gain in-demand skills directly applicable to various roles, including public affairs, communications, and emergency response, thus enhancing career prospects within the urban mobility and transportation management fields.
Participants will gain practical experience through case studies, simulations, and potentially even real-world projects, strengthening their ability to navigate the complexities of crisis communication in the dynamic environment of urban mobility systems. This program ensures that graduates are well-prepared for navigating the challenges presented by incidents impacting public transport, traffic management, and overall urban mobility.
